Ibrahimović families are mainly Bosniaks and they are mostly from Podrinje (Bosnia), also Croats (iz Tuzla Region, Bosnia), very rarely Roms. In the past century, relatively most of Croatian residents bearing this family name were born in Zagreb and in Bosanian Posavina (Gradacac area). In Pobuđe in Podrinje (Bosnia) every second inhabitant had the family name Ibrahimović.
Prevalence
About 270 people with faimily name Ibrahimović live in Croatia today, in 120 households. There were 10 of them in the middle of the past century, and their number multiplied. They are located in the most of Croatian counties, in 34 cities and 30 other places, mostly in Zagreb (90), Pula (25), Garica on the Island of Krk (20), Sibenik (15), and in Rijeka (15).
Outside Croatia
Family name Ibrahimović (including: Ibrahimovic , Ibrahimovich ) is present in 54 countries worldwide.
In the sources analysed in the project Acta Croatica so far, the name is mentioned over five times, the first time 1942 in source Phone Directory of the Independent State of Croatia 1942.
